#1 My friend is planning to buy a new pontoon boat-when are the better deals; at the annual boat shows in January or now while dealers are trying to close out 2018 inventory?

#2 He is considering the Yamaha 150 HP 4 stroke or the Merc VTech 150. (Freshwater river application)
 
Mine was advertised as an after boat show special. As I recall I got it for 24% off MSRP. My Yahama 150 does all that I ask of it. It runs quiet, had no problems and stopped my grandchildren from saying go faster. There are many options available but the top three for me were the SPS, extended rear deck, and power steering.
 
I bought both of mine in the fall which got me next years model for current year pricing during the off season, and I was able to capitalize on yamaha's extended warranty promotions. I have the Yamaha F200 and love it.
 
I believe the Yamaha 150 is the best bang for your buck. We love ours. If you've got the dough to move up to a 225 or 250, by all means.

The Yamaha 150 has been a great engine. I got mine especially because it has had a long run since about 2005 or 2006 when its' last major tweak was done so any "new" bugs have been worked out. It is not as tech as the 200's with fly by wire but has been shown to be bulletproof. It can be had with command link instruments which will display any engine data you want. If you do not need more than 150 I would say it is an excellent choice. I can not comment to the Merc but I would not trade the Yamaha 150 for any engine and have been around boats for a long time and did massive research when I got mine 2 years ago.
